Just to let you know this is not an accepted treatment as far as the pet passport system goes. Our new import had to go into quarantine overnight because this was used & had to be done again with Frontline.

I was using the frontline spot on not spray now having switched to stronghold (which by the way also worms the dogs) i have had no problems and the only reason it doesnt say its for ticks is because its not licensed for ticks which is why its no good for the passport, but believe me it works!!
